Tata Motors evaluating CNG and hybrids for larger cars above 4 metres

17 Nov 2025 | Category: Business

Tata Motors says its strong EV-CNG mix keeps it well within CAFÉ compliance, but it is studying CNG use up to 4.3 metres and exploring strong hybrids for larger cars and SUVs if segment competitivenes
